It is what you make of it.
The RA instructors likely have more experience and knowledge about these trucks than anyone else. They will take you to the (near) limits of the truck and teach you about the various off road modes of the truck and using the rear lockers.
I doubt many have not put their truck in a 30 degree bank without doing it at RA first. The instructors answered everyone’s questions about the truck and mods.
It is also a social event to meet others with similar interests and hobbies. A great way to make connections.
The photography they will take for you is a bonus.
The option to bring a driving guest is new.
Enjoy!

If you like tracks the look up TORR (also does a couple trail runs a year as well) and/or Savage. I just got back from a trail run with TORR down in black water forest in florida. We covered about 100 miles per day. Last year we went to talladega forest in Alabama. I think we are going to do part of the trans American trail this fall too.

Just depends on what you are looking for. It isn’t California where you can just hop off the highway and run some desert, but there are places wide enough to do some exploring. A good place to start looking is state parks/forests, national parks/forest. I think there are a few apps that help you find trails near you.

The track events are fun too. Going to VIR in April.

Edit:

I forgot about silver lake sand dunes in Michigan, they also have a trail system there as well.
